Description

Découvrez le meilleur de Tromsø lors de cette visite guidée de 4 heures conçue pour vous aider à découvrir l'histoire, la culture et les paysages du nord de la Norvège. Vous explorerez l'île de Tromsø, en apprendrez davantage sur son passé fascinant et profiterez d'une vue imprenable sur les environs. Votre voyage vous mènera à travers l'île de Kvaløy, où vous pourrez admirer le paysage côtier et visiter la plage de Telegrafbukta. Vous profiterez également d'une visite guidée au musée universitaire de Tromsø, où vous pourrez vous plonger dans la culture, la nature et le patrimoine arctique de la région. Pour parfaire votre aventure, vous traverserez le continent et visiterez l’impressionnante cathédrale arctique avant de retourner au centre-ville ou au quai de votre bateau de croisière. Vous pouvez participer à cette expérience que vous utilisiez un fauteuil roulant, que vous ayez une déficience visuelle ou auditive ou que vous soyez neurodivergent. Chaque circuit est conçu pour être inclusif, vous assurant de vous sentir accueilli et soutenu tout au long de votre voyage.

relaxed, easily accessible tour, worth the money

It was booked through the cruise company. It was a 4hr tour that involved a mini-bus rather than a coach which meant a small group. Guides were friendly and knowledgeable. They made sure that everyone was safe walking on snow/ice. There was room for wheelchair users, but my group did not have anybody who used a wheelchair. It was an 8:30am start, which meant lovely views of the morning sun at Telegrafbukta Beach. They guide also gave us a tour of the Tromso University Museum instead of just letting us find our own way through the exhibits. Included time for individuals to look around the museum. Since some people needed walking aides, the driver tried to get to the main entrance of the Arctic Cathedral. Unfortunately it was too difficult for the mini-bus. Entrance to the cathedral and museum were included. A good view of the highlights of Tromso, the time flew past, nothing seemed rushed
